Ingredients You’ll Need

The best part about this Mermaid Water Mocktail is that each ingredient brings a distinct touch, from flavor to appearance. The list is short and effortless, but choosing the right brands and knowing their role will make your mocktail unforgettable.

  • Pineapple Juice: Sweet, tangy, and golden, this juice forms the base layer, bringing that tropical flavor and a gorgeous color contrast.
  • Gatorade Zero Sugar Berry Flavored: This bold blue drink is the middle layer, offering a fruity zip while helping create the signature “mermaid” gradient.
  • Gatorade Frost Glacier Freeze: Light, refreshing, and slightly paler blue, it floats beautifully on top to achieve the dreamy ombre effect.
  • Tall Glass: Transparent is best to showcase all those magical layers — it’s a feast for the eyes as much as the tastebuds!
  • Ice Cubes: Not just for chilling; the ice helps slow the mixing so distinct layers form, plus adds a crisp, refreshing chill.

How to Make Mermaid Water Mocktail

Step 1: Prep Your Glass

Start by grabbing your tallest, clearest glass. Fill it all the way to the top with ice cubes. Want to use a straw? Slip it in now, before you pour anything, so you don’t accidentally stir up your beautiful layers later on.

Step 2: Add the Pineapple Juice

Pour pineapple juice directly over the ice, filling the glass a little more than a third of the way. This forms the golden base and gives that bright, juicy tropical taste you’ll love in every sip.

Step 3: Layer the Gatorade Zero Berry

Time for some magic! Very, very slowly pour the Gatorade Zero Sugar Berry flavored drink over the back of a spoon (rounded side up) held just above the ice. Let it trickle gently onto the pineapple juice; this trick helps keep the layers as separate and defined as possible. Pour until your glass is about three-quarters full.

Step 4: Top with Gatorade Frost Glacier Freeze

Finish by slowly pouring the Gatorade Frost Glacier Freeze over another spoon or steady stream, letting it float on top of the blue layer. These two blues may slightly blend into a gentle ombre, but they should remain distinctly above the pineapple layer. Snap a photo — your Mermaid Water Mocktail is ready!

FAQs

Can I make a big batch of Mermaid Water Mocktail for a party?

Absolutely! For a crowd, prep the ingredients separately (pouring into pitchers), then assemble individual drinks just before serving to keep those magical layers intact. Try setting up a self-serve station for extra fun.

What’s the secret to getting perfect layers?

The trick is pouring very slowly, ideally over the back of a spoon held just above the ice and liquid. Different sugar content and density in each drink help them separate, but patience is key for those crisp, even layers in your Mermaid Water Mocktail.

Can I use other flavors or brands?

You can absolutely experiment! Try swapping in other blue sports drinks or juices that are similarly dense. Mango juice or pink lemonade also make beautiful and tasty substitutions for unique Mermaid Water Mocktail variations.

Is the Mermaid Water Mocktail suitable for kids?

Yes! This mocktail is completely alcohol-free, making it a wonderful family-friendly treat for birthdays, pool parties, or just a whimsical weekend surprise for the kids.

How can I make the Mermaid Water Mocktail extra fizzy?

For a sparkling twist, add a splash of lemon-lime soda or club soda on top before serving. Pour it gently to keep your layers as intact as possible, and enjoy the subtle bubbles!

Ingredients

Pineapple Juice

Gatorade Zero Sugar Berry Flavored

Gatorade Frost Glacier Freeze

Tall Glass

Ice Cubes

Instructions

  1. Fill the Glass with Ice: Start by filling your glass completely to the top with ice cubes.
  2. Pour Pineapple Juice: Pour the pineapple juice over the ice, filling the glass a little over a third full.
  3. Add Gatorade Zero Berry: Slowly pour the Gatorade Zero Berry over the pineapple juice, filling the glass about ¾ full.
  4. Layer Gatorade Frost: Lastly, pour the Gatorade Frost Glacier Freeze slowly over the Gatorade Zero Berry to create the layered effect.
